Transaction cca0775ebd363d2b0e989529d5a2b2c0206d7fd35b68bb0d56896a87a9978350

block
a4dd1bbd8bcba68e9c7505307ab1dca0318b05ba58a36b1b62c7201517529952

1 Input

24 Outputs